/**
- * gst_type_find_suggest_simple:
- * @find: The #GstTypeFind object the function was called with
- * @probability: The probability in percent that the suggestion is right
- * @media_type: the media type of the suggested caps
- * @fieldname: first field of the suggested caps, or NULL
- * @...: additional arguments to the suggested caps in the same format as the
- * arguments passed to gst_structure_new() (ie. triplets of field name,
- * field GType and field value)
- *
- * If a #GstTypeFindFunction calls this function it suggests the caps with the
- * given probability. A #GstTypeFindFunction may supply different suggestions
- * in one call. It is up to the caller of the #GstTypeFindFunction to interpret
- * these values.
- *
- * This function is similar to gst_type_find_suggest(), only that instead of
- * passing a #GstCaps argument you can create the caps on the fly in the same
- * way as you can with gst_caps_new_simple().
- *
- * Make sure you terminate the list of arguments with a NULL argument and that
- * the values passed have the correct type (in terms of width in bytes when
- * passed to the vararg function - this applies particularly to gdouble and
- * guint64 arguments).
- *
- * Since: 0.10.20
- */
